Adobe Inc. Financial Breakdown (FY 2025)
Source: Yahoo Finance โ ADBE annual filings (2025) โ$23.8B revenue ยท $8.7B operating income ยท $7.1B net income
- โOperating margin: 36.6% on $23.8B in revenue.
- โR&D is 18.1% of revenue ($4.3B).
- โNet income margin: 30.0% โ $7.1B in profit.
- โFree cash flow: $9.9B (41.4% of revenue).

About Adobe Inc.
Adobe Inc., formerly Adobe Systems Incorporated, is an American multinational computer software company based in San Jose, California. It offers a wide range of programs from web design tools, photo manipulation, and vector creation to video and audio editing, mobile app development, print layout and animation software.
